REVOLUTIONARY WAR Era EUROPEAN MARTIAL FLINTLOCK Pistol 18th Century .57cal

With Bust on the Pommel

Here we present an antique European Martial Flintlock, made circa the early-to-mid-18th Century, possibly in France. This pistol bears strong resemblance to the pistol portrayed in George C. Neumann’s The History of Weapons of the American Revolution page 180. Neumann notes that this pistol was in the Morristown National Historical Park Collection at the time of publishing and he notes that it is a French Cavalry Pistol. Each of these pistols has a 14-1/2” barrel with an S-shaped sideplate and Crown proof. Full length stock. This one is in .57 caliber and has a bust on the bottom of the pommel.

The American colonists used a vast array of weapons due to their not having robust domestic manufacturing capabilities. Many of the weapons they used were made by small shops and even more were imported from Britain and mainland Europe, especially France, who would first lend support and materiel before getting involved themselves.

The overall condition is good. Gray patina throughout. The action is excellent. The bore is smooth and patinated. The stock has a small repair above the tail of the lock as well as under the forestock at the muzzle; otherwise solid. A large and impressive pistol from the 18th Century!
